首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
软件开发中的瀑布模型典型地刻画了软件生存周期各个阶段的划分,与其最相适应的软件开发方法是(9)。
软件开发中的瀑布模型典型地刻画了软件生存周期各个阶段的划分,与其最相适应的软件开发方法是(9)。
admin
2010-05-10
77
问题
软件开发中的瀑布模型典型地刻画了软件生存周期各个阶段的划分,与其最相适应的软件开发方法是(9)。
选项
A、构件化方法
B、结构化方法
C、面向对象方法
D、快速原型方法
答案
B
解析
软件开发包括需求分析、设计、编码、测试和维护等阶段。瀑布模型将软件生命周期划分为制定计划、需求分析、软件设计、程序编写、软件测试和运行维护等6个基本活动,并且规定了它们自上而下、相互衔接的固定次序,如同瀑布流水,逐级下落。瀑布模型强调文档的作用,并要求每个阶段都要仔细验证。结构化开发方法的生存周期划分与瀑布模型相对应,因此也是与其最相适应的软件开发方法。对于本题的选项A,OMG描述构件的定义为,构件是一个物理的、可替换的系统组成部分,它包装了实现体且提供了对一组接口的实现方法。构件化方法是以过程建模为先导、以构架为中心、基于构件组装的应用系统开发方法。它可以裁剪为面向对象方法,适合于构件组装模型。构件化方法和面向对象方法鼓励构件组装(复用),面向对象过程沿演化的螺旋迭代,因此它们与瀑布模型软件开发思路不相适应。对于选项C,对象是指由数据及其容许的操作所组成的封装体。所谓面向对象就是基于对象概念,以对象为中心,以类和继承为构造机制,来认识、理解、刻画客观世界和设计、构建相应的软件系统。而面向对象方法是一种把面向对象的思想应用于软件开发过程中指导开发活动的系统方法,简称OO(Object-Oriented)方法。对于选项D,快速原型模型的第一步是建造一个快速原型,实现客户或未来的用户与系统的交互,用户或客户对原型进行评价,进一步细化待开发软件的需求。通过逐步调整原型使其满足客户的要求,开发人员可以确定客户的真正需求是什么;第二步则在第一步的基础上开发客户满意的软件产品。显然,快速原型方法可以克服瀑布模型的缺点,减少由于软件需求不明确带来的开发风险,具有显著的效果。
转载请注明原文地址:https://kaotiyun.com/show/NOtZ777K
本试题收录于:
网络管理员上午基础知识考试题库软考初级分类
0
网络管理员上午基础知识考试
软考初级
相关试题推荐
(2013年上半年上午试题51)采用顺序表和单链表存储长度为n的线性序列,根据序号查找元素,其时间复杂度分别为________。
使用ADSL接入Internet,用户端需要安装________协议。
(2013年下半年上午试题41~43)在面向对象技术中,______(41)定义了超类和子类之间的关系,子类中以更具体的方式实现从父类继承来的方法称为______(42),不同类的对象通过______(43)相互通信。(41)
对于长度为m(m>1)的指定序列,通过初始为空的一个栈、一个队列后,错误的叙述是()。
以下关于网络中各种交换设备的叙述中,错误的是(66)。
高级程序设计语言中用于描述程序中的运算步骤、控制结构及数据传输的是(20)。
在‘你好吗?<p>我很好’中加入<p>,运行结果是()。
云存储系统一般有命名服务器、元数据服务器和_________。
在Windows7中,剪贴板是用来在程序和文件间传递信息的临时存储区,此存储区是______。
A local area network(LAN)is the communication of a number of computers by(66)connecting to each one in a single location, usuall
随机试题
关于甲状腺癌哪项是错误的
大叶性肺炎的病理特点有
A.恶性高热B.Ⅱ度房室传导阻滞C.肺栓塞D.中度贫血E.强直性脊柱炎使呼气末二氧化碳浓度显著增高的是
以保护信托财产的完整,保护信托财产的现状为目的而设立的信托,称为()。
下列关于留置权的说法,正确的是()。
学习是否发生变化的标志是___________。
成人往往按照自己习惯设计的蓝图去要求、塑造儿童,使儿童的天性得不到发展,这是因为在制定学前教育目的时未考虑到()。
自我观是指个人对自己及自己与他人和社会关系的观念系统。成人前期的自我观的特点是()
______inordertosaveoil,thenationalspeedlimitdecreasedfrom60mphto55inthe1970s?______itisimportantforadriv
【B1】【B5】
最新回复
(
0
)